Hamilton remains confident: 'We're still the best team'

Despite the recent dip in form, Lewis Hamilton has given his team Mercedes a vote of confidence as he came out and says the Silver Arrows are "still the best team" in Formula 1, as the five-time champion finished fourth after a questionable strategy call. The Brit put in a massive qualifying lap to somehow get on the front row on the grid despite Mercedes' lack of pace at the Marina Bay Street Circuit, and he had a promising start of the race. He was right on top of Charles Leclerc until the Monegasque pitted first.  As Hamilton reveals, he wasn't a fan of this strategy, as he had proposed something else.
